119th birth anniversary of Brig Rajinder Singh celebrated

Samba, June 14

District administration Samba today organized a programme to pay tributes to Brigadier Rajinder Singh on his 119th birth anniversary at his native village Rajinder Pura (Bagoona).
Brigadier Rajinder Singh sacrificed his life for the nation on October 27, 1947 while fighting thousands of tribal raiders assisted by Pakistani army at Buniyar, Uri Sector in . While paying homage to Brig Rajinder Singh MVC, Legislator Chander Parkash Ganga exhorted upon the youth to remember the martyr and imbibe the qualities of bravery and valor. Highlighting the life of Brig Rajinder Singh, Deputy Commissioner, S Rajinder Singh Tara said that it is a matter of great pride that such a great warrior was born in our state. He also saluted him for his bravery and supreme sacrifice. ADC Samba, PO ICDS, ASP, ACD, SDM Vijaypur, Executive Engineers PHE, PWD & PDD, BDO Vijaypur, Ravi Kant from Radio Kashmir , Maj General (Retd) Goverdhan Singh Jamwal, daughters of Brig Rajinder Singh and people in large number were present on the occasion and paid rich tributes to Brig Rajinder Singh. Cultural programme was presented by students of Brig Rajinder Singh Memorial Fauji Public School and GHS Rajinder Pura on the occasion.
Dogri songs highlighting the bravery of Brig Rajinder Singh were presented by Songs and Drama division of Ministry of Information, Government of on the occasion.
